Transaction 7fbd2553123ae23b0a09caa665145937c16bded5343fc34fe63f8e24eed1705e
1 Input
1 Output
-
7fbd2553123ae23b0a09caa665145937c16bded5343fc34fe63f8e24eed1705e:0
- value
- 21297
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 adca4c06ebb8ad81cb7a3665bbe6e1a48e62b7dd OP_EQUAL
- address
- 3HXwAa5FDhctsJMYv467WDUL9Hbze5VAHc